It is a concrete boat ramp that provides access to Rock Lake, a popular recreational and fishing destination in the area.
The ramp is reportedly 20 feet wide and has a maximum water depth of around six feet. It can accommodate a variety of watercraft, including fishing boats, kayaks, canoes, and pontoons. However, there may be size and horsepower limitations in place, so it's important to check with local authorities before launching any craft.
Overall, the Rock Lake - Mill Pond Rock Lake Access boat ramp offers a convenient and safe way for visitors to enjoy all that Rock Lake has to offer. Whether you're looking to fish, paddle, or just enjoy a day out on the water, this ramp is a great place to start.
